Introducing Timeline. Your Customer Interactions Organized.
The Timeline allows users to view the history of interactions and communication with customers. The improved Timeline now enables users to view overdue and future activities, providing a 360-degree view of all interactions - past, present, and future.
Historical data records what has happened with a customer, while future activities serve as leading indicators for sales leaders to assess account health. An account with no scheduled future activities suggests a lack of customer relationship-building, potentially putting it at risk. Sales leaders can review upcoming customer discussions with account managers, offering suggestions and coaching. They can also check for overdue tasks, ensuring no critical responsibilities are overlooked.
The changes in the Timeline tab include:
- Add Upcoming and Overdue sections to display future and overdue appointments and tasks.
- Provide a grid view to display more data at a glance.
- Include an Actions panel to make the Timeline tab consistent with other tabs.
- Allow filtering items by interaction categories.
- Open the associated entries, allowing users to view all relevant data without leaving Timeline.
Timeline view
Users will see the historical data grouped by months. Use the Show All option to view interactions with other contacts in the same company.
Clicking the name of an Address Book/Contact List entry or associated Opportunity/Account or Case/Service Plan opens a pop-up to show the details of the entry. This allows users to view all the relevant information without leaving the tab.
The Upcoming and Overdue section displays tasks and appointments in chronological order. Overdue activities appear at the top of the list, followed by future activities. If Show All option is on, users can see all the overdue and future activities with all contacts from the same company. Upcoming and Overdue section will be collapsed by default.
Grid view
Use the switch on the right to change to grid view. This view displays data in columns. Clicking on subjects opens a dialog showing interactions, notes, emails, appointments, and tasks. Clicking on the name of an Address Book entry, opportunity, or case opens a pop-up dialog with details of the associated entry. Users can resize column width and reorder columns by drag and drop. The settings will be remembered automatically.
The grid view also includes Upcoming and Overdue section.
When one or multiple items are selected, the Delete button will appear. Users can delete multiple items at the same time.
Clicking the Filters button will expand the header bar and show the filter fields. Users can filter items by Users, Types and Interaction Categories.
Use the search field to quickly find items.
Timeline in other modules
The updated Timeline tab is available in Address Book/Contact List, Opportunities/Accounts, Customer Service/Client Service Plans, Leads, and Hotlist module.
Timeline tab in Opportunities
Users can view the timeline of an opportunity or include the interactions with the associated Address Book entries in the timeline.
